    One alternative to Vitamin A supplements is Beta-Carotene. Beta-Carotene is a precursor to Vitamin A and is converted to Vitamin A in the body as needed. It is considered a safer option as it is not possible to overdose on Beta-Carotene as the body only converts it to Vitamin A as needed.

    Food Sources of Beta-Carotene:

    Beta-Carotene is found in various fruits and vegetables such as carrots, sweet potatoes, spinach, kale, mangoes, and apricots. Consuming a diet rich in these foods can help maintain adequate levels of Beta-Carotene in the body.

    Health Benefits of Vitamin A 25,000 IU (7500 mcg)

    1. Supports Vision Health

      Vitamin A is essential for maintaining good vision, especially in low light conditions. It helps to prevent night blindness and age-related macular degeneration.

    2. Boosts Immune System

      Vitamin A plays a crucial role in enhancing the immune system by supporting the production and function of white blood cells, which help fight off infections and diseases.

    3. Promotes Skin Health

      It is essential for maintaining healthy skin by supporting cell growth and repair. Vitamin A can help prevent acne, reduce wrinkles, and improve overall skin texture.

    4. Supports Reproductive Health

      Vitamin A is important for reproductive health in both men and women. It plays a role in sperm production in men and fetal development in women.

    5. Antioxidant Properties

      As an antioxidant, Vitamin A helps protect cells from damage caused by free radicals, which can lead to chronic diseases such as cancer and heart disease.
